Noo I havent put any oil in the gearbox, ive put 2 stroke oil in the engine oil

2 stroke oil goes in the plastic bottle at front of bike,,,,under the handlebars,,,,,,,,,, 2 stroke oil doesn't go anywhere else.

10w40 or 10w50 MOTORBIKE engine oil goes in the gearbox/engine. small black cap on right side of engine, above brake pedel

No other oils go in your bike.

If this is not what you have done, then don't start your bike
